Build Up Event
Build Up hosted an event at the end of June entitled ‘Value to the Client: How can building design and construction teams give best value to clients in terms of cost and performance?.
This was an evening of presentations and discussions involving Build Up participants and speakers from Experian and Urban Design London. The discussions centred around the current and future state of the economy and how innovation and collaboration could offer more value to clients.
The event was well attended by Built Environment professionals, businesses, professional bodies and government agencies. Professor Jim Coleman from Regeneris Consulting was MC on the night.

Head of UK Construction Forecasting at Experian, James Hastings provided some interesting economic analysis of the road to recovery for the sector. Director at Urban Design London, Esther Kurland addressed many of the different aspects of contemporary street design within the UK, outlining in particular some of the most important practical steps to better streets.
Participants also presented their perspectives on the challenges that they have faced and how the Build Up programme has assisted them. Report findings from participants on some of Build Up programme’s live collaborative projects were also summarised at the event, including the Borough High Street, Retrofitting Soho and London Bridge Viaducts projects.
